Amerita is an entrepreneurial-founded company and a wholly owned subsidiary of PharMerica. The home infusion market is positioned for rapid growth driven by the aging population, increase in chronic diseases, robust pipeline of infusible drugs coming to market, and an industry shift from hospital delivery settings to lower-cost, high-quality alternative providers such as Amerita.
Responsibilities
- Captures and documents initial and ongoing assessment of specific patient, drug and disease information to identify real and potential drug-related problems or needs
- Escalates to a clinician as needed
- Answers inquiries from patients, families, physicians and other healthcare professionals
- Maintains thorough and appropriate documentation in the customer/patient record of all clinical activities and communication with patients, physicians and other healthcare professionals
- Picks and pulls supplies and home medical equipment
- Obtains supply inventories from patients/clients and communicates information obtained to the Pharmacist as required and documents all communication in patient progress notes on the pharmacy computer system
- Participates in branch management, department and intra-departmental meetings and quality improvement activities
- Adheres to all accreditation, OSHA, FDA, state, local and federal regulations and standards relevant to infusion pharmacy and home medical equipment

Qualifications
- Successful completion of an approved/accredited pharmacy technician training program; IV certification preferred
- Registered Pharmacy Technician license in state of practice per state regulations
- National Pharmacy Technician Certification as required by the state board of pharmacy in state of practice
- One to three (1-3) years of related pharmacy experience in a home care setting, retail, or pharmacy setting
- General knowledge of drug terminology, pharmaceutical calculations, drug use and aseptic techniques
- Effective mathematical and communication skills required
- Basic pharmacy knowledge of reading and interpreting prescriptions
- The ability to work independently, accurately, and efficiently
- Valid driver’s license, preferred
